Malia Obama headed to Harvard

Malia Obama is following in her parents footsteps with plans to head to Harvard University.

US President Barack Obama's eldest daughter Malia will attend Harvard University in 2017 after taking a year off from studies following her high school graduation in June.

"Malia will take a gap year before beginning school," a White House statement said on Sunday, breaking a months-long silence about Malia's university search.

Both Obama and Michelle Obama attended Harvard Law School.
